                Here's my situation, the band I'm in does a lot of different styles of music. I'll go from AC/DC right into a very clean Sheryl Crow. My TSL has 3 channels and each channel has their own gain/volume/reverb/bass/trem/mid. I'm able to tweak each channel to get the sound I like. I've noticed that most of the ENGL's while having multiple channels, they only have 1 set of gain/mid/trem ...etc... If you like more mids on your clean channel over the lead channel, do you have to once you switch to the clean channel, manually have to change your mids? Can you preset each channel and store the settings some how or are you constantly have to change things live?

                  I know the Blackmore has only one eq setting across the board but my Savage has two. One for Ch.'s 1&2, and one for Ch.'s 3&4.
